A leading accountancy firm in Glasgow is seeking a Manager for its Business Advisory team. This role involves managing a portfolio of clients, providing comprehensive advisory services while developing professional relationships.
Candidates should possess strong communication skills, relevant experience, and qualifications such as ICAS or ACCA.
The firm offers opportunities for personal and professional growth in a supportive environment. This is an exciting opportunity for someone looking to advance their career.

How to prepare for a job interview at Johnston Carmichael Chartered Accountants and Business Advisers
✨Know Your Numbers
As a Strategic Business Advisory Manager, you'll need to demonstrate your financial acumen. Brush up on key financial metrics and be ready to discuss how you've used data to drive business decisions in the past.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
Strong communication is crucial in this role. Prepare examples of how you've effectively communicated complex information to clients or team members. Practise artic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ently.
✨Understand the Firm's Culture
Research the accountancy firm's values and culture. Be prepared to discuss how your personal values align with theirs and how you can contribute to their supportive environment.
✨Prepare Thoughtful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street. Prepare insightful questions about the firm’s approach to client management and professional development opportunities.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
